My favourite radio program is “The Sunday Edition”on the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ation (CBC). Last weekend they broadcast a really great documentary about how Google dominates web search. From the show description:
“If search rules the web, then Google rules search. And that fact has given the company an enormous amount of economic clout. It has made the Google algorithm, the top-secret computer program that runs the search engine, the most important piece of intellectual property in the world. With so much at stake, it’s no wonder that the clamour for more public scrutiny and even regulatory control is getting louder every day.“
The documentary is called “Engineering Search: The Story of the Algorithm that Changed the World” it’s about 25 minutes of great radio, and it’s available online here (it’s in the “second hour” of the show).
